What is an Orbital Stretch Wrapping Machine?
The Orbital Stretch Wrapping Machine is a state-of-the-art packaging equipment designed to securely wrap various types of products, including ring, horizontal, and door-shaped items. It utilizes a unique orbital wrapping technique that ensures maximum stability and protection during transit. This machine is equipped with advanced technologies and can accommodate different sizes and shapes, making it a versatile choice for a wide range of industries.
Benefits of Using an Orbital Stretch Wrapping Machine:
1. Enhanced Protection: The primary purpose of any packaging solution is to protect goods from damage. The Orbital Stretch Wrapping Machine excels in this aspect by securely holding the products in place, preventing them from shifting or getting damaged during transportation.
2. Cost Efficiency: By investing in an Orbital Stretch Wrapping Machine, businesses can significantly reduce packaging costs. This machine optimizes the use of stretch film, minimizing waste and reducing the need for additional packaging materials.
3. Time Savings: Traditional manual packaging methods are time-consuming and labor-intensive. The Orbital Stretch Wrapping Machine automates the entire process, allowing for faster and more efficient packaging. This enables businesses to meet tight deadlines and increase overall productivity.
4. Versatility: The Orbital Stretch Wrapping Machine caters to a wide range of products, making it suitable for various industries. Whether you need to wrap ring-shaped items, horizontal goods, or even doors, this machine can handle it all. Its flexibility and adaptability make it a valuable asset for businesses of all sizes.
Applications of the Orbital Stretch Wrapping Machine:
1. Manufacturing Industry: The manufacturing industry relies heavily on efficient packaging to ensure products reach their destination in pristine condition. The Orbital Stretch Wrapping Machine can wrap products of various shapes and sizes, including automotive parts, machinery components, and more.
2. Logistics and Distribution: In the logistics and distribution sector, the Orbital Stretch Wrapping Machine plays a vital role in protecting goods during transit. By securely wrapping pallets and ensuring stability, this machine minimizes the risk of damage and ensures customer satisfaction.
3. Construction Industry: Door frames, windows, and other construction materials are susceptible to damage during transportation. The Orbital Stretch Wrapping Machine offers a reliable solution by providing a secure and protective wrap, safeguarding these items from scratches, dents, and other potential hazards.
